Chapter 120
Psal Geneva15 120:1  A song of degrees. I called vnto the Lord in my trouble, and hee heard me.
Psal Geneva15 120:2  Deliuer my soule, O Lord, from lying lippes, and from a deceitfull tongue.
Psal Geneva15 120:3  What doeth thy deceitfull tongue bring vnto thee? or what doeth it auaile thee?
Psal Geneva15 120:4  It is as the sharpe arrowes of a mightie man, and as the coales of iuniper.
Psal Geneva15 120:5  Woe is to me that I remaine in Meschech, and dwell in the tentes of Kedar.
Psal Geneva15 120:6  My soule hath too long dwelt with him that hateth peace.
Psal Geneva15 120:7  I seeke peace, and when I speake thereof, they are bent to warre.
